Spring Cloud 基于 Spring Boot,为微服务体系开发中的架构问题,提供了一整套的解决方案——服务注册与发现,服务消费,服务保护与熔断,网关,分布式调用追踪,分布式配置管理等。 3.1 Spring Cloud优点 1.有强大的 Spring 社区、Netflix 等公司支持,并且开源社区贡献非常活跃。 2.标准化的将微服务的成熟产品和框架结合一起...
SpringBootServerlessApplication.java 复制 package com.icoderoad;importorg.springframework.boot.SpringApplication;importorg.springframework.boot.autoconfigure.SpringBootApplication;@SpringBootApplicationpublicclass SpringBootServerlessApplication {publicstatic void main(String[]args){ SpringApplication.run(SpringBootSer...
集成配置部署验证SpringBootProject- String projectName-void createProject()Istio- String version+void integrate()ServiceMesh- String service-void configure()Service- String serviceName+void deploy()Verification+boolean verify() 总结 通过本文的指南,你可以学会如何实现Spring Boot Service Mesh。首先需要创建一...
Spring Boot是基于Spring框架的快速开发框架,为开发人员提供了一种简单快速地构建应用程序的方式,Spring Boot通过提供自动配置,减少了开发人员的工作量,并提供了许多开箱即用的特性,使开发人员能够快速开发高效的应用程序。 Spring Cloud是一组用于构建分布式系统的框架和工具集合,主要包括服务注册与发现、配置管理、熔断器...
服务迁移之路 | Spring Cloud向Service Mesh转变 一、导读 Spring Cloud基于Spring Boot开发,提供一套完整的微服务解决方案,具体包括服务注册与发现,配置中心,全链路监控,API网关,熔断器,远程调用框架,工具客户端等选项中立的开源组件,并且可以根据需求对部分组件进行扩展和替换。
在微服务领域,Spring Cloud和Service Mesh是备受关注的两种解决方案。它们都致力于解决微服务架构中的复杂问题,但在实现方式和应用场景上存在一些差异。本文将从技术架构、应用场景和实际效益三个方面对Spring Cloud和Service Mesh进行比较,帮助你更好地理解它们的优劣。一、技术架构Spring Cloud是基于Spring Boot框架的扩展...
spring cloud 和service mesh是什么关系 专家官方解答 : Spring Cloud 和 Service Mesh 是两种不同的微服务架构解决方案,它们在实现微服务治理方面有交集但侧重点不同。 Spring Cloud:Spring Cloud 是一套基于 Spring Boot 的微服务开发工具集,它为开发者提供了在分布式系统(如配置管理、服务发现、断路器、智能路由、微...
提到微服务,当下最火热微服务治理的框架无疑就是Spring Cloud,它基于Spring Boot可实现快速集成,开发效率极高的特性,堪称中小型互联网公司的福音。 随着需要治理的微服务数量越来越多,着手解决服务间通信的复杂性问题被提上日程,Service Mesh作为后起之秀,在2016年被Paypal、Lyft、Ticketmaster和Credit Karma等一些国外大...
基于Spring Boot+Istio的Service Mesh微服务架构示例代码 什么是云原生? 云原生是基于分布部署和统一运管的分布式云 以容器、微服务、DevOps等技术为基础建立的一套云技术产品体系。 这里以K8s作为注册中心。K8s service作为服务间负载均衡器。网关使用k8s中的ingress(也可以用别的),所以原则上实现云原生。只需要spring bo...
微服务是近些年来软件架构中的热名词,也是一个很大的概念,不同人对它的理解都各不相同,甚至在早期微服务架构中出现了一批四不像的微服务架构产品,有人把单纯引入Spring Boot、Spring Cloud框架也叫做微服务架构,却只是将它作为服务的 Web容器而已。 随着微服务的火热,越来越多的团队开始实践,将微服务纷纷落地,并投入生产...